Sagard, Mecklenburg-Vorpommern, Germany

Overview

Sagard is a charming small town on Rügen island, best known for its natural beauty, relaxing atmosphere, and proximity to scenic parks and Baltic Sea beaches. It combines rural tranquility with a touch of historic character in its center.

Best Time to Visit

May to September for mild weather and outdoor activities

Local Tips

Rent a bicycle to explore the surroundings and nearby Jasmund National Park. Grocery stores may close early on Sundays, so plan ahead.

Cultural Etiquette

Tipping (5-10%) is appreciated in cafes and restaurants; casual dress is common, but beachwear should stay at the shore. Greetings with a friendly 'Guten Tag' are expected.

Safety Warnings

Sagard is very safe but take basic precautions against pickpocketing around train stations. Watch for ticks when hiking in forested areas.

Hidden Gems

Visit the nearby Spyker Castle, the mineral spring park, and the secluded paths through Jasmunder Bodden for birdwatching.
